    can I mount my amps upside down?

    Thats my question to all of the audio guru's. I just got a Alpine MRV-F545 (an upgrade in power from the MRV-F345 that I have)and I also have a MRD-605. (quick back story) I work at a reading truck bodies and we fab-up bodies using sheet metal. So I'd like to fab-up a new deck lid probably outta aluminum with reinforcing. So with that said i'd like to get these amps off the floor so I have more room in the hatch. My original plan was to mount the amps up side down but some people have told me that you cant. Input?

    Heatsinks are made to dissipate heat.

    Most companies plan on people installing the amp normal, meaning it's heatsink is upwards.

    By flipping the amp over, the heat will stay inside the amp, not allowing it to cool properly.

    Can you do it?

    Yes. But, take a few precautions and make sure there is a fan or two moving air across them.

    Not a great idea to mount passively cooled amps upside down, will it work? probably.... For the reasons stated earlier here, hot air rises from the passive heat sinks and therefore moves air across them. If the amp is mounted in such a way as to prevent the flow of air (such as the top of your trunk) it would be at risk of thermal damage. Perhaps mounting it sideways is an option.

    Passive heatsinks rely on the hot air moving across them and rising thus carrying it away, then drawing cooler air from around the amp kind of like a pump. An amp that is mounted upside down in an enclosed space will not force hot air away from it too draw in cool because hot air is not carried away. In fact it builds up and will eventually cause either thermal overload or a failure. The cause of the failure is not due to amp orientation but because the amp is mounted to the high point.

    Good advise is to stay away from mounting your passively cooled electronics in such a way as to defeat their design.
